Step 1: Assessment and Planning
We’ll send a team of experts to your property to assess the damage, identify the source of the leak, and create a customized plan to get your attic dry and safe. This process typically takes 30 minutes to an hour.
Step 2: Water Removal and Drying
Our team will use specialized equipment to remove standing water and dry out the affected area. We’ll also use dehumidifiers to reduce the moisture levels in the attic, preventing further damage. This process typically takes 2-3 days, depending on the severity of the damage.
Step 3: Leak Detection and Repair
Once the area is dry, our team will identify and repair the source of the leak to prevent future damage. This may involve replacing roof tiles, repairing gutters, or sealing gaps in the attic.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
We’ll thoroughly clean and sanitize the affected area to remove any mold or bacteria that may have grown during the water damage. This is an essential step to prevent health risks and ensure your attic is safe to inhabit.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Certification
After the job is complete, our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ure the area is dry and safe. We’ll also provide a certification of completion and a detailed report of the work we’ve done.

Warning Signs You Need Attic Water Removal in Snoqualmie, WA
Ignoring water damage in your attic can lead to costly repairs and even health risks. Here are some warning signs you shouldn’t ignore: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, unpleasant odors in your attic can show mold growth, which can spread to other areas of your home. If you notice a musty smell that persists even after cleaning, it’s time to call our team.
Water Stains on Your Ceiling
Water stains on your ceiling or walls can be a sign of a larger issue, like a leaky roof or faulty gutters. Our team can help you identify the source of the problem and provide a solution.
Warped or Buckled Ceiling Tiles
Warped or buckled ceiling tiles can show water damage that’s causing structural issues. If you notice this in your attic, it’s essential to address the problem quickly to prevent further damage.
Visible Signs of Mold or Mildew
Mold or mildew growth in your attic can be a serious health risk. If you notice black spots, white patches, or a slimy texture on your walls or ceilings, it’s time to call our team.
Unexplained Pests or Rodents
Unexplained pests or rodents in your attic can show a moisture issue that’s attracting unwanted critters. Our team can help you identify the source of the problem and provide a solution.
Unusual Noises or Sounds
Unusual noises or sounds in your attic, like creaking or dripping, can show water damage that’s causing structural issues. If you notice this, it’s time to call our team.

Attic Water Removal Cost in Snoqualmie, WA
The cost of Attic Water Removal in Snoqualmie, WA can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ction and drying |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, equipment required |
| Leak detection and repair | $1,000 – $5,000 | Location and complexity of leak, type of repair required |
| Mold remediation and sanitation | $1,500 – $6,000 | |
| Attic insulation and ventilation | $1,000 – $3,000 | Size of affected area, type of insulation required |
